The international orthopedic market is seeing unprecedented growth, driven by an aging global population, rising rates of high-energy sports and vehicular accidents, and growing demand for minimally invasive surgeries. B2B procurement in this space requires navigating complex technical requirements and regulatory changes.
Global medical distributors frequently struggle with sub-standard biocompatibility tests, inconsistent dimensional tolerances, regulatory documentation gaps (like CE MDR and FDA 510k), and unreliable lead times that disrupt surgical center inventories.
Uncompromised trace element control in Titanium Alloys (ASTM F136 / ISO 5832-3) is critical. Suppliers must deliver verified raw materials to guarantee tensile strength and prevent intraoperative component failure.

Our engineering efforts focus on material biomechanics, optimizing screw head geometries, and enhancing plate surface science to improve osteointegration and reduce healing times.
Medisplint utilizes advanced electrochemical surface anodization processes to create protective, bioactive titanium oxide layers. This technique minimizes ion release, reduces bacterial colonization, and enhances cellular attachment for better healing.
Additionally, our variable-angle locking designs permit up to 15 degrees of screw angulation, allowing surgeons to customize fixations dynamically to fit specific fracture patterns.
Every design profile undergoes rigorous stress testing. Using dynamic fatigue testers, we run implants through millions of stress cycles to verify fatigue limits. Torsional tests assess locking mechanisms, and pull-out tests help optimize thread designs for poor bone quality.
